Living with Erectile Dysfunction: Tips for Coping and Support
Erectile impotence can affect a man's self-esteem and relationship with his partner. It's important to remember that you're not alone and there are steps you can take to manage this condition. Considering professional help from a doctor or therapist is a positive first step. They can identify the underlying reason of your ED and recommend the best treatment for you. In addition to professional guidance, there are habit changes that may assist helpful.
* Engaging regular exercise can improve blood flow and overall well-being.
* Preserving a healthy nutrition low in trans fats can improve your cardiovascular system.
* Addressing stress through techniques like yoga or meditation can have a positive impact on ED symptoms.
Remember, open dialogue with your partner about your worries is important. Sharing your story can help you both understand each other better and work together to find answers.

Erectile Dysfunction and Heart Health: A Connection to Consider
Erectile dysfunction can indicate underlying health problems, particularly those affecting the heart. While it may seem like a purely sexual challenge, the connection between erectile dysfunction and heart health is undeniable. This pair of problems share common triggers such as high blood pressure, high cholesterol, diabetes, and smoking. These conditions can damage blood vessels, restrict blood flow, and increase the risk of both ED and cardiovascular disease. Consequently, it's crucial for men experiencing ED to talk to their doctor. Early detection and treatment of underlying health issues can significantly improve heart health and overall well-being.
